Output 2666d62004395ba938ddb9e82f386bd2afb7f40dc03ec7ed4f949256cb4f974d:112

value
65536
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b26fbc83cc4e8e3e2247860df60b95397598d2ce009b0d5824af1c4b4d969758
address
bc1pkfhmeq7vf68rugj8scxlvzu4896e35kwqzds6kpy4uwyknvkjavq5dvfh2
transaction
2666d62004395ba938ddb9e82f386bd2afb7f40dc03ec7ed4f949256cb4f974d
spent
true